Rating a stock in CAPS consists of three components:

Your call - Will this stock outperform or underperform the S&P 500? Successful picks are measured in terms of whether or not you were correct and by how many percentage points.

Your time frame - A guideline for other members to see whether your thinking is short or long-term. Time frame is also used to calculate the stock rating, but is not used in the scoring of your pick.

Your pitch - Here's your chance to offer more detailed thoughts, analysis, concerns, or the rationale behind your call. The pitch is optional and may be added later.

Each time you rate a stock, CAPS updates the community intelligence for the company, which may or may not change its CAPS rating. For more information, visit the Help tab at the top of the page.

Avatar Lance912 (89.04) Submitted: 8/28/07 4:00 AM : Underperform Start Price: $5.41 SVLF Score: 62.99

I think a lot of people give this company a thumbs up on caps without knowing much about it. Silverleaf is notorious for its high pressure/almost scam-like tactics that are at the very least questionable and quite possibly illegal.

They send out postcards randomly to people telling them they've won a prize. To claim the prize, they need to take a 90 minute tour. After the tour, they end up winning a Vegas or Orlando vacation that is almost impossible to redeem based on what I've read.

Do a search for "Silverleaf resorts" or "awards verification center" (the name they use for the direct mailing spam). Many, many complaints. Granted, their target market right now probably doesn't use the Internet much, and a fool is born every day, but my guess is that as more and more people search the Internet about them before buying, fewer and fewer will. It's much easier to scam people pre-Google.

This is very much a 5+ year pick. I can't see their marketing tactics working in 5 years, when I expect people will be doing a Google search about any major thing they buy on their pda. I'm sure they use these marketing tactics for a reason, and without them, we have to expect they'll make far less profits.
